This weekend i decide to take out my carbs, and inspect them deeply as i can...
I realized that 1 & 3 needle have much more wear than others:



I little time ago i bought 2 3en carb sets for spares, so i take the best 2 needles of them and install them, they were close perfect than the good ones on the carbs....
Then i saw that 1 & 3 springs was 3-4mm longer than others, so replace them with 4 equal springs... A diafram plastic cover #4 has a crack on it, so i replaced with a perfect one.
I cleaned every parts and all passages again...
Set again pilot screw 3 turns out.
Finally, i decided to set the float height again... Someone said that float height it's 13-14mm but this just for 1WG Carbs ... I make own research cause there not to much topics about 3en carbs, but can't find much about them.... As it seems the float height will be 24mm since the 3en carbs are almost the same as 600 3he carbs... Here a post that i found about these carbs:
viewtopic.php?f=35&t=36106 .
Set to 24mm, and put them on the bike..
Then turn it on and it feels ok, I take it for a ride, it was good on low, mid & high Rpms. The problem happens when i go on high rpms and quickly remove the throttle, in the moment that i almost stop it, it feels overrich and it turned off.... Then when i tried to turn it on, was a lot easier than before.... So, there was some improvement, but its not working as it suppose to be...
